A diagnostic imaging service engineer is responsible for the installation, maintenance, and repair of medical imaging equipment such as X-ray machines, CT scanners, MRI machines, ultrasound devices, and nuclear medicine systems. They work closely with healthcare professionals to ensure that the equipment is functioning properly and producing accurate diagnostic images. Their duties include troubleshooting technical issues, calibrating equipment, replacing faulty parts, and conducting routine inspections. They may also train medical staff on the proper use and maintenance of the equipment. A diagnostic imaging service engineer needs to have strong technical skills, knowledge of medical imaging technology, and the ability to work independently. They must stay updated on the latest advancements in imaging technology and adhere to safety regulations and protocols.

Diagnostic Imaging Service Engineer salary in Estonia
Average Yearly Salary of Diagnostic Imaging Service Engineer in Estonia is approximately 38,730 EUR (38,665 USD). Data is for 2025 and indicates a pre-tax value. The salary itself depends on multiple factors such as seniority, job performance, certifications, experience or any other bonuses. The value indicated is an average amount based on records we have in database. Real values may vary. The data is for orientational purposes.
